Nutritional Information

Island Breeze Jelly Beans contains 350 calories per 100g, with 0g of protein, 0g of fat, and 90g of carbohydrates (70g of which is sugar). The high carbohydrate content further confirms that this product is not suitable for a ketogenic diet.
